Commit Graph

102 Commits

Author SHA1 Message Date
efischer 9ee7b4ba8a bugfix 2020-06-17 17:01:51 -05:00
efischer 4a1cf74066 initial commit 2020-06-17 16:57:37 -05:00
efischer 0daafbe767 rename to distinguish btw number and word sorters 2020-06-17 16:50:25 -05:00
efischer fdca76f02a Renamed Sorter to NumberSorter 2020-06-17 16:43:45 -05:00
efischer 0e6223e863 error catching 2020-06-17 16:41:54 -05:00
efischer ce77a6e048 removing old code 2020-06-17 16:14:40 -05:00
efischer a48fbbdb88 simplifying iterator use 2020-06-17 16:13:44 -05:00
efischer dc162ca35e bugfix 2020-06-17 14:46:14 -05:00
efischer 3fe9324606 More iterator stuff 2020-06-17 14:43:47 -05:00
efischer 2b2097c7d2 trying iterators 2020-06-17 14:33:42 -05:00
efischer beb6d741a8 storing sort index value 2020-06-16 13:50:24 -05:00
efischer 9321f47616 Bug fix 2020-06-16 13:47:42 -05:00
efischer 9910ec23b2 adding linked list version of insertion sort 2020-06-16 13:44:08 -05:00
efischer 72895d3cfd New number files 2020-06-11 14:18:53 -05:00
efischer 743109d03e Merge branch 'master' of https://github.com/eugenefischer/Tutoring-APCompSci 2020-06-11 14:09:23 -05:00
eugenefischer a8f921577a Merge pull request #3 from eugenefischer/revert-2-revert-1-StreamTest
Revert "Revert "Stream test""
2020-06-11 14:06:37 -05:00
eugenefischer 31a6ad5cf8 Revert "Revert "Stream test"" 2020-06-11 14:06:24 -05:00
eugenefischer c8ea19c3dc Merge pull request #2 from eugenefischer/revert-1-StreamTest
Revert "Stream test"
2020-06-11 14:04:02 -05:00
eugenefischer 435a9ef718 Revert "Stream test" 2020-06-11 14:03:27 -05:00
eugenefischer 87cf8a3e05 Merge pull request #1 from eugenefischer/StreamTest
Stream test
2020-06-11 13:59:31 -05:00
efischer ebb5069a44 revert 2020-06-11 13:55:01 -05:00
efischer 43829780c2 added new number files 2020-06-11 13:54:16 -05:00
efischer b614b0d0ce rewritten to use streams 2020-06-11 13:48:53 -05:00
efischer 3c49635303 now using Stream and try-with-resources syntax 2020-06-11 12:48:08 -05:00
efischer 50506d4465 remove old code 2020-06-11 12:25:46 -05:00
efischer 3ac8c7e315 bug fix 2020-06-11 12:24:06 -05:00
efischer 3ffcb05d13 use writeToArray() method 2020-06-11 12:20:13 -05:00
efischer 5a45b0ca3e Add number range to output 2020-06-11 12:17:33 -05:00
efischer ba8820896e file now only read once 2020-06-11 12:00:27 -05:00
efischer 7f59fadc42 advance scanner past bad input on error 2020-06-11 11:05:47 -05:00
efischer c67a2f25d5 removing extraneous override 2020-06-08 15:39:01 -05:00
efischer 5cac156f29 update flowchart 2020-06-08 13:44:48 -05:00
efischer 6472b7a902 finished flowchart 2020-06-08 13:38:32 -05:00
efischer 8ddce68e4d bug fix 2020-06-08 12:35:06 -05:00
efischer cb3dca5d62 editing sort type strings 2020-06-08 12:35:00 -05:00
efischer d3398c9b65 bug fix 2020-06-08 12:06:05 -05:00
efischer d9b51e1c53 adding three-way partitioned quick sort 2020-06-08 12:00:51 -05:00
efischer 9f0ce5056d implementing 3-way partition quicksort 2020-06-08 11:56:48 -05:00
efischer 9d501eb6c8 changing quickSort() so it can be overridden 2020-06-08 11:56:07 -05:00
efischer ad3bc3a431 Class to implment three way partition quick sort 2020-06-05 19:01:27 -05:00
efischer 52095c928d adding usage flowchart 2020-06-05 14:42:23 -05:00
efischer f6bd8bbfc7 added constructor to allow variant subtyping 2020-06-05 14:14:11 -05:00
efischer 64fc5d553f new random number files 2020-06-05 14:09:49 -05:00
efischer 288e70a7a2 deleting random number files without max value 2020-06-05 13:44:24 -05:00
efischer b7452d22be bugfix: now prints max number entered, not max-1 2020-06-05 13:43:05 -05:00
efischer 02f551cf0c Refactor to use writeToArray() method 2020-06-05 13:40:07 -05:00
efischer 6eb7f2046a refactor to use writeToArray() method 2020-06-05 13:20:11 -05:00
efischer 3bb022d745 writeToArray() bugfix 2020-06-05 13:19:51 -05:00
efischer 6364af3947 adding a writeToArray method and documenting code 2020-06-05 13:12:17 -05:00
efischer bc3b45ff12 adding more detail to class diagram 2020-06-04 22:09:53 -05:00